Kenya Airways adds 787 routes

Far East destinations and is continuing to move its flights to Nairobi’s new Terminal 1A. After receiving its fourth 787 on Aug. 28, Kenya Airways has deployed the twinjet on its existing Nairobi-Bangkok-Guangzhou and Nairobi-Bangkok-Hong Kong services. These join its initial 787 routes, which...
